Transaction 1a0731e28c76102c79a10e75cd15c6ef42b8ce79fe8ea442c0fd5c5c6499d77a

block
539f84d29df1a6e07e930e291515df967b13c60f23091b2b8695218147fd4790

1 Input

23 Outputs